US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"fast arrangement"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when referring to a quick or prompt organization of something, such as an event or meeting. Example: "We need to make a fast arrangement for the conference to ensure everything is in place before the attendees arrive."

Linguistic Context

The phrase "fast arrangement" functions as a noun phrase where "fast" modifies the noun "arrangement". It describes the manner in which something is organized, emphasizing the speed or rapidity of the organization.

How does "fast arrangement" differ from "efficient arrangement"?

"Fast arrangement" emphasizes speed, whereas "efficient arrangement" highlights resource optimization and productivity. While a "fast arrangement" might be efficient, an efficient arrangement is not always necessarily fast.
